Sequoia Capital China has led an over 100 million yuan ($15 million) Series B+ round funding in Chinese innovative biotechnology firm Moon (Guangzhou) Biotech Co., Ltd (MoonBiotech), per a company statement on Thursday. 

The company will use the proceeds to expedite the commercialisation of pipeline candidates. 

Set up in 2015, MoonBiotech uses novel microbial separation and cultivation technologies to provide innovative microbial products and solutions. Its offerings such as microorganisms and metabolites meet the needs of covering biomedicine and biological agriculture industries. 

State-backed Yuexiu Financial Holdings’ investment arm Yuexiu Industrial Fund has been a long-time backer in MoonBiotech. Prior to this round, the industrial fund had exclusively infused ‘millions of US dollars’ in MoonBiotech’s Series B round in 2020. Prior to that, it had also invested in the firm’s pre-A round in 2018 and angel round in 2015.
